Malicious code in @diezyyasha/libsignal-node (npm)

T1195.002 · Compromise Software Supply ChainT1059.007 · JavaScriptT1574.002 · DLL Side-LoadingT1078 · Valid Accounts

Analysis

@diezyyasha/libsignal-node@2.2.8 is a trojanized clone of the libsignal-node crypto library. The package ships the genuine libsignal-node source tree but adds an install module that runs when the package is required: it locates the installer's @whiskeysockets/baileys (WhatsApp) package and overwrites lib/Socket/newsletter.js with a modified version. The injected code waits 120 seconds after a Baileys socket is created, then silently issues a newsletter FOLLOW request for the hardcoded channel id 120363407277177688@newsletter using the victim's authenticated WhatsApp session, auto-subscribing the victim's account to that channel without consent. A marker file is written to prevent re-patching. No credentials are exfiltrated; the tampering abuses the victim's own WhatsApp session to inflate a newsletter's follower count.
